A recruitment agency in Burford seeks a Studio & Operations Manager to oversee the daily management of a creative studio on a private estate. The ideal candidate will be highly organised, adept at project coordination, and confident in handling budgets and scheduling.

Key responsibilities include:

  • Administration
  • Financial tracking
  • Liaising with suppliers

This is a hands-on role requiring a calm and professional individual thriving in a fast-paced environment.

How to prepare for a job interview at The Burford Recruitment Company Ltd

✨Know Your Studio Inside Out

Before the interview, do your homework on the creative studio and its operations. Familiarise yourself with their projects, style, and any recent news. This will show your genuine interest and help you tailor your answers to align with their vision.

✨Showcase Your Organisational Skills

Prepare examples that highlight your organisational abilities. Think of specific instances where you successfully managed budgets, schedules, or coordinated projects. Be ready to discuss how you keep everything running smoothly in a fast-paced environment.

✨Be Ready for Financial Discussions

Since financial tracking is a key part of the role, brush up on your budgeting skills. Be prepared to discuss your experience with managing finances and how you ensure projects stay within budget. This will demonstrate your capability in handling one of the core responsibilities.

✨Practice Calm Communication

In a hands-on role like this, communication is crucial. Practice articulating your thoughts clearly and calmly, especially when discussing how you handle supplier relationships or resolve conflicts. This will reflect your professionalism and ability to thrive under pressure.
